This is precisely why music cover licensing is crucial. It's about respecting the rights of the original songwriters and publishers who poured their creativity into the song. Without proper licensing, you are effectively using someone else's intellectual property without their consent or compensation, which can lead to serious legal issues.

When you cover a song, you are creating a new sound recording of an existing musical composition. Therefore, you must obtain permission to use that original composition.
